Hanoi (VNA) – The fourth National Youth Fine Art Festival, which is slatedfor October, will open for submissions from June 19 to 23, as heard at aceremony in Hanoi on April 28.

Organizers fromthe Department of Fine Arts, Photography and Exhibition under the Ministry ofCulture, Sports and Tourism, said they welcome creative works on contemporarylife, stressing that the works must not violate patent.

Each oflocal artists, aged between 18 and 35 years old, can submit a maximum of twoentries, which are in the form of photos or CDs and have been made between 2014and June 2017.   

The entriesmust not be displayed previously at any other national exhibitions oprganised bythe department.

Selectedsubmissions will be exhibited at the October festival and compete for 3 first,6 second and 9 third prizes.
